Does Leino Stay for the Remainder of his Contract?
We were all underwhelmed by Ville's entire first year in the blue and gold. He wasn't all that good in any one aspect of the game, so many of us have called for the buyout.
But then came his return from injury this year. In his 3 games (small sample size), he's really looked like a player who deserves his 4.5 mil salary. Not only does he look more comfortable under a new coach, but he seems to have "adjusted" to our style of play. His skating and puck possession are a strength, and he's benefitting from getting minutes with Hodg/Pom. We'll have to see how the rest of the season goes, but we may have spoken too soon when we called for a buyout. Leino looks like he really wants to be here, and be a key member of the team. If he can keep up this level of play, I have no problem with keeping him in the top 9.
